PHP: differenze tra le versioni

Contenuto cancellato Contenuto aggiunto
elimino sezione "Confronto con ASP.NET" come da discussione.
aggiornamento
Riga 48:
A partire dal 5 febbraio 2008, a causa dell'iniziativa ''GoPHP5'' sostenuta da una serie di sviluppatori PHP, molti dei progetti open-source di alto profilo cessano di supportare PHP 4 nel nuovo codice e promuovono il passaggio da PHP 4 a PHP 5.<ref>{{Cita web|url=https://pear.php.net/gophp5.php|titolo=GOPHP5!|sito=pear.php.net|accesso=26 settembre 2017}}</ref>
 
La versione 5 di PHP ha raggiunto la release 5.6 prima di essere abbandonata dal punto di vista dello sviluppo e supporto nel gennaio 2019.<ref name=":0">{{Cita web|url=https://www.php.net/eol.php|titolo=PHP: Unsupported Branches|sito=www.php.net|lingua=en|accesso=2022-12-12}}</ref>
 
=== PHP 7 ===
Il 3 dicembre 2015 è stata rilasciata la versione 7, attualmentearrivata ancorafino inalla faseversione di sviluppo e attivamente supportata7.4.33.<ref>{{Cita web|url=https://www.php.net/ChangeLog-7.php|titolo=PHP 7 ChangeLog|accesso=28 febbraio 2020}}</ref> Il supporto della versione 7.4 è terminato nel novembre 2022.<ref>{{Cita web|url=https://www.php.net/supported-versions.php|titolo=PHP: Supported Versions|sito=www.php.net|lingua=en|accesso=2022-12-12}}</ref>
 
=== PHP 8 ===
Il 27 novembre 2020 è stata rilasciata la versione 8.<ref>{{Cita web|url=https://www.php.net/ChangeLog-8.php|titolo=PHP 8 ChangeLog|accesso=2022-01-12}}</ref> E' la prima versione di PHP a supportare la [[Compilatore just-in-time|compilazione just-in-time]] aumentando di gran lunga le prestazioni.<ref>{{Cita web|url=https://stitcher.io/blog/jit-in-real-life-web-applications|titolo=PHP 8: JIT performance in real-life web applications|sito=stitcher.io|data=2 luglio 2020|lingua=en|accesso=2022-12-12}}</ref>
 
== Caratteristiche ==
Riga 74:
È sempre buona norma rivedere la propria configurazione di PHP, contenuta generalmente nel file php.ini, per controllare le funzionalità attivate. Di solito nel file stesso si documentano 3 tipi di configurazioni: Configurazione di PHP ''di default'', configurazione in un ''ambiente di sviluppo'' che consente per esempio di vedere a video gli errori e configurazione in un ''ambiente di produzione'' in cui tipicamente gli errori vengono scritti in un file di log.<br />
 
Nel sito ufficiale è presente l'archivio storico delle [[Release (informatica)|versioni]] dismesse, aggiornato a maggio del 2019.<ref>{{cita web | url name= https"://www.php.net/releases/index.php0" | titolo = Archivio storico delle versioni non più supportate | lingua = en | urlarchivio = https://web.archive.org/web/20061112043714/https://www.php.net/releases/index.php | urlmorto = no | accesso = 15 maggio 2019 }}</ref>.
 
==== Attacchi hacker ====
Riga 484:
|26 novembre 2023
|-
|'''8.1'''
|25 Novembre 2021
|25 novembre 2023
|?? Novembre 2024
|-
|'''8.2'''
|8 dicembre 2022
|??8 Novembredicembre 2024
|}